Latest odds ahead of Saturday’s ‘Battle of Britain’

Daniel Dubois is the odds-on favourite to beat Joe Joyce and add the European heavyweight title to his British and Commonwealth belts on Saturday.

Both boxers have unbeaten records heading into the bout – who’ll leave the ring with theirs still intact? Dubois is now 2/7 to win, with Joyce at 11/4 and 25/1 for the draw.

“It promises to be a sensational bout between two of the most promising British heavyweights. There is lots at stake, with the winner sure to be elevated into the mix for some of the biggest fights on offer, and we make Dubois the odds-on favourite to come out on top,” said Coral’s Harry Aitkenhead.

Our traders also have YouTuber Jake Paul odds-on to beat former NBA player Nate Robinson. Paul is the 2/5 favourite as the pair meet on the undercard of Mike Tyson’s return to the ring.

“YouTube and the NBA are colliding in the ring before we see Tyson’s exhibition return, and we make Jake Paul the favourite to triumph in that fight,” added Aitkenhead.
